Dmitriy Kobitskiy: IPA CIS Activities Are Inextricably Linked with St. Petersburg

Secretary General of the IPA CIS Council Dmitriy Kobitskiy addressed the international conference “Role of St. Petersburg in the Development of Russia’s Diplomatic Relations with the CIS Countries”.

Dmitriy Kobitskiy noted that the IPA CIS was the only international organization whose headquarters are located in St. Petersburg. According to the Secretary General, the IPA CIS headquarters had become a platform for major congress events, in which representatives of legislative and executive authorities of the CIS, business and academia exchange best practices, discuss topical issues of international cooperation. He also presented in detail the main fields of the Assembly’s work and spoke about common points of the CIS MPs today.

In addition, the Secretary General spoke about the “Children of the Commonwealth” Forum, which took place for the first time in St. Petersburg in 2021 with the support of the St. Petersburg City Administration. Another significant initiative was the first international forum “Commonwealth of Fashion” held in the Tavricheskiy Palace on 19 October 2022. Dmitriy Kobitskiy also noted International Tourism Forum Travel Hub “Commonwealth”, which brought together representatives of tourism industry, government agencies, non-profit organizations and business.

At the end of his speech, the Secretary General expressed his gratitude to the leadership of the Committee for External Relations of St. Petersburg for cooperation, as well as strong and continued support of the IPA CIS activities in various fields.
